変形楽譜矯正ソフト Stavealign -------------------------------------------------------------- https://www.mingw-w64.org/downloads/ "MingW-W64-builds" からダウンロード https://www.javadrive.jp/cstart/install/index6.html に従って gcc コンパイラをインストール c_env.bat:  環境変数を設定してコマンドプロンプトを開けるバッチファイル。  ダブルクリックで起動。  (環境変数を設定してサインインを繰り返してもパスが有効に   ならない場合にその都度 path を設定するもの。現在では多分不要。) 開いたコマンドプロンプトで、1回だけ gcc stavealign.c -o stavealign -lm -Wall これで stavealign.exe が生成される。 以下で変形楽譜の bmp を矯正できる(出力名は任意) stavealign 1.bmp n1.bmp stavealign 6.bmp n6.bmp bmp は gimp で生成したものに対応。他の bmp は未確認。 左端と右端には縦線が入っていることが必要。 縦線の内側のエッジをトレースする。stavealign を走らせる度に トレース確認用の stavealign.bmp が生成される。 stavealign.bmp で、赤の太線が参照されたデータ、黄色は候補となったが 使われなかったデータ、水色細線は最終決定された中心線、両端の青 マークが検出された左右端エッジ、ピンクマークはその修正位置を表す。 ここにある画像以外の動作確認をしていないので、問題ある場合は iwamuro@kusastro.kyoto-u.ac.jp まで、うまくいかない画像とともに メールで送って下さい。また、2048 以上のピクセル数の画像変換も 必要であればご相談下さい。